Service Quality Ratings

Approved children's education and care services across Australia are assessed and rated by their state and territory regulatory authority. The NQS is part of the National Regulations and includes seven quality areas that are important to children's learning and developmental outcomes.


Overall rating

Services are given a rating for each NQS quality area and an overall NQS service quality rating based on these results. The overall rating provides a snapshot of how the service is performing.
